PayPal to open up network to cryptocurrencies
PayPal will allow customers to hold bitcoin and other virtual coins in its online wallet and shop using cryptocurrencies at the 26 million merchants on its network. The new service makes PayPal one of the largest US companies to provide consumers access to cryptocurrencies, which could help ...
